Marietta, Ga., (Life U. Release) – Life University Rugby has announced that it will conduct a search for a new Men's Rugby Head Coach after the news that current Head Coach Andrew “Tui” Osborne informed Life U officials today that he and his family will be relocating at the end of October.

AIC ’center Adrian Ray was a central part of his team’s victory over NEC this past weekend.

Ray, a power-running midfielder out of the Perry Street Prep program in Washington, DC, provided one of the great highlights of the day, thundering over a defender to score one of AIC’s four tries on the night.

The University of Minnesota-Duluth swept the field at the All-Minnesota tourney men’s college bracket, taking first place.

The Fighting Penguins had little trouble with most of their opponents, although Winona State provided a stern test in the final - a game Duluth won 26-12.

St. Louis University moved to 2-0 and Principia to 1-0 in the Gateway Rugby Conference.

Principia won 33-26 over Missouri-Kansas City (UMKC) in the Thunder Chickens’ first league game, while travel problems forced Southern Illinois to forfeit to Maryville. St. Louis, meanwhile, won 50-7 over Central Missouri.
